Caroline Rider’s "Consider the Horse" Training Programs are designed to teach participants the following:

GROUND MANNER CONTROL & CONFIDENCE
+ How to read and understand our horse’s body language: expressions, attitudes and opinions.
+ Better insight into the way horses think and learn: why making the right thing easy and the wrong thing difficult works (comfort vs discomfort).
+ How to develop focus, projection of energy, feel and timing within us – and why it’s important.
+ How to problem solve and become better prepared to handle our horses when they do the unexpected.
+ How to develop confident, light, responsive and willing partners in our horses – through feel and timing.
+ How to gain control of our horses five main body parts.
+ How to develop “mental engagement” and join up without a round pen.
+ How to develop patience in our horses: tieing and ground tieing; clipping; standing for the farrier and vet.
+ How to properly prepare your horse to lunge –with respect and purpose.
+ How to teach your horse self-carriage through long-line driving.
+ How to trailer load, work through obstacles and so much more!
